Transaction 520616d3fa72d6d3d2bb02039d2b038659d839382a1311280cda96e6eb7e8f52

2 Input
1 Outputs
  • 520616d3fa72d6d3d2bb02039d2b038659d839382a1311280cda96e6eb7e8f52:0
  • value  3256794
    address  3K6TQWZ4sDzKffvR5afXehQe2yoYFd7Bq3